About this opportunity

This senior leadership role sets the Group’s strategy for data privacy and records management. You’ll lead a small expert team, strengthen our privacy and records capabilities, and ensure our approach remains compliant, resilient and future‑focused. The role also explores opportunities to use AI to enhance privacy and records processes while maintaining the highest regulatory and ethical standards.

What you’ll do

  • Define and deliver the Group’s data privacy and records management strategy.
  • Maintain the Group’s privacy and records frameworks, standards and controls.
  • Lead governance activity and provide expert guidance on privacy risk.
  • Oversee breach reporting, the central ROPA, cross‑border data transfers and compliance dashboards.
  • Support the development of privacy skills and capability across the organisation.

What you’ll need

  • Extensive experience in data privacy and records management in a large financial organisation.
  • Strong knowledge of GDPR and global data transfer requirements.
  • Proven strategic leadership and ability to manage specialist teams.
  • Experience with emerging technologies, including AI and PETs.
  • Strong analytical, governance and risk management skills
